Deep Dive into Machine Learning: Adaptive Algorithms

Machine learning represents a powerful field in computer science, enabling algorithms to learn from data without explicit guidance. These advanced algorithms can interpret vast amounts of information, uncovering patterns and relationships that would be impossible for humans to perceive. By training on labeled data, machine learning algorithms can solve problems with increasing accuracy.

  • Uses of machine learning are extensive, including fraud detection, personalized experiences, and medical diagnosis. As technology evolves, the potential of machine learning is anticipated to increase even further.

Deep Dive into Neural Networks

Delving thoroughly the realm of neural networks unveils a intriguing world. These synthetic intelligence systems emulate the architecture of the human brain, enabling them to learn from massive datasets. Neural networks consist interconnected units organized in levels, each performing transformations. The firing of these nodes propagates through the network, finally producing results based on the inputinformation.

Furthermore, the training process involves methods that modify the parameters between nodes, enhancing the network's accuracy. Neural networks have revolutionized domains such as image recognition, demonstrating their potential in solving challenging problems.
